The division-ring embedding conjecture for torsion-free group algebras

Let GG be a torsion-free group and let K\mathbb{K} be a field. The division-ring embedding conjecture. The group algebra K[G]\mathbb{K}[G] embeds into a division ring.

This is a strengthening of Kaplansky's zero-divisor conjecture, which only asserts that K[G]\mathbb{K}[G] has no zero divisors. The source states that this strengthening is wide open; it is motivated by the fact that the Strong Atiyah Conjecture implies the zero-divisor conjecture for torsion-free groups.
